Pumps & Gearboxes
Pumps and Gearboxes specialise in the supply, design, installation, commissioning and services of pumps and gearboxes in domestic, commercial and industrial systems.
Pumps and Gearboxes hold a large stock of EOV pumps ready for same day despatch!
Contact Pumps & Gearboxes & Crest Pumps Now